If you are an unsheltered than this is where you need to come. You have access to Case Management, showers, laundry, meals, and they don't look down on you. Everyone will have a different experience but I can say that if you show respect and keep to yourself, you will be treated fairly. This place really helped me so I would highly recommend this organization.
